Operant Chamber
A laboratory apparatus used to study animal behavior in a controlled environment, particularly for experiments in operant conditioning.
Extinction
Extinction in psychological terms refers to the gradual weakening and eventual disappearance of a conditioned response when the conditioned stimulus is no longer paired with the unconditioned stimulus.
Contingency Management
A behavior modification technique that involves varying reinforcement conditions to change behavior.
Assessment
The systematic evaluation of processes, characteristics, or outcomes often used to measure knowledge, skills, attitudes, or abilities.
